December 9,1891
Messrs Armour & Co.
Kansas City, Mo.,

Gentlemen:-
Your favor of the 3rd inst., is at hand.

Your prices on meat and poultry, as quoted, were higher than those of other dealers, and on the 2nd inst., we purchased a car load of supplies in Kansas City, which is due tonight.

The turkeys cost us 13 ½ cents and the chickens 11 cents.

I am sorry you were not able to give us prices which would enable us to give you orders, as we anticipate to use much more provisions this season than during any previous one.

Yours truly,
E. S. Babcock.
